The Qatari wrestling team left today to participate in the 2019 World Wrestling Championships held in Kazakhstan from September 14 to 22. The competitors are seeking to win medals as well as ensure qualification for the 2020 Summer Tokyo Olympics.
The Qatari wrestling team seeks during this tournament to win medals in order to qualify for the 2020 Summer Tokyo Olympics.
The Qatari team will participate with two players, Abdul Rahman Ibrahim, (70 kg) in freestyle wrestling and Bader Bakhit Sharif, (77 kg) in Greco-Roman wrestling.
The President of the Qatar Boxing and Wrestling Federation (QBWF) Yousuf Ali Al Kazim confirmed that the Qatari team is ready to compete in the tournament, and the players are seeking to win medals and qualify for the 2020 Summer Tokyo Olympics.
